Ingredients for Tuna & Seaweed Mini Wraps

Gathering the right ingredients is key to making these delightful Tuna & Seaweed Mini Wraps. Here’s what you’ll need:

  • Tuna: A can of drained tuna is the star of this dish. It’s packed with protein and adds a savory flavor.
  • Mayonnaise: This creamy element binds the tuna together, giving it a rich texture. You can use regular or light mayo based on your preference.
  • Soy Sauce: Just a teaspoon adds a touch of umami, enhancing the overall flavor. If you’re watching sodium, opt for low-sodium soy sauce.
  • Nori (Seaweed): These sheets are essential for wrapping. They provide a unique taste and are rich in nutrients.
  • Cucumber: Thinly sliced, it adds a refreshing crunch. Feel free to substitute with other veggies like bell peppers for a twist.
  • Avocado: Creamy avocado slices bring a buttery richness. If you’re not a fan, you can skip it or use hummus instead.
  • Sesame Seeds: A sprinkle on top adds a nutty flavor and a lovely presentation. You can also use chopped green onions for extra zing.

For those who like a little heat, consider adding a dash of sriracha to the tuna mixture. The exact quantities of these ingredients are listed at the bottom of the article for your convenience, ready for printing!

How to Make Tuna & Seaweed Mini Wraps

Step 1: Prepare the Tuna Mixture

Start by opening your can of tuna and draining it well. In a mixing bowl, combine the drained tuna with mayonnaise and soy sauce. Use a fork to mix everything together until it’s well blended. The creamy mayo and savory soy sauce will elevate the tuna’s flavor, making it irresistible. This mixture is the heart of your Tuna & Seaweed Mini Wraps, so make sure it’s nice and creamy!

Step 2: Lay Out the Nori

Next, grab a sheet of nori and lay it flat on a clean surface. Make sure the shiny side is facing down. This will be your wrap, so it’s important to have a good foundation. If you’re new to nori, don’t worry; it’s quite forgiving!

Step 3: Spread the Tuna Mixture

Now, take a spoonful of your tuna mixture and spread a thin layer over the nori. Leave a little space at the edges to make rolling easier. The tuna should cover most of the nori, but don’t overdo it. You want to keep it neat and tidy!

Step 4: Add Fresh Ingredients

On top of the tuna, add your thinly sliced cucumber and avocado. The cucumber adds a refreshing crunch, while the avocado brings a creamy texture. Feel free to arrange them however you like, but don’t pile them too high. You want to keep your wraps manageable!

Step 5: Roll the Wrap

Carefully roll the nori away from you, starting at the edge closest to you. Tuck the filling in as you roll, making sure it’s tight but not too tight. You want the wrap to hold together without squishing the ingredients. This step is where the magic happens!

Step 6: Repeat and Slice

Once you’ve rolled your first wrap, repeat the process with the remaining ingredients. After rolling all your wraps, take a sharp knife and slice them into bite-sized pieces. This makes them perfect for snacking or sharing. Plus, they look so pretty on a plate!

Step 7: Garnish and Serve

Finally, sprinkle some sesame seeds over the sliced wraps for a delightful finishing touch. This adds a nutty flavor and a bit of crunch. Serve your Tuna & Seaweed Mini Wraps immediately for the best taste, and watch them disappear!

Tips for Success

  • Make sure to drain the tuna well to avoid a soggy wrap.
  • Use a sharp knife to slice the wraps for clean edges.
  • Keep the nori sheets covered with a damp cloth to prevent them from drying out.
  • Experiment with different veggies for added flavor and crunch.
  • Serve immediately for the best texture, but they can be stored in the fridge for a few hours.

Variations

  • Spicy Tuna: Add a teaspoon of sriracha or chili paste to the tuna mixture for a kick of heat.
  • Vegetarian Option: Replace tuna with mashed chickpeas or tofu for a plant-based twist.
  • Herbed Tuna: Mix in fresh herbs like cilantro or dill to brighten the flavor profile.
  • Crunchy Add-ins: Toss in shredded carrots or radishes for extra crunch and color.
  • Gluten-Free: Ensure the soy sauce is gluten-free or substitute with tamari for a safe option.

FAQs about Tuna & Seaweed Mini Wraps

Can I make Tuna & Seaweed Mini Wraps ahead of time?

Yes, you can prepare the tuna mixture in advance and store it in the fridge. However, I recommend assembling the wraps just before serving to keep the nori crisp and fresh.

What can I substitute for nori if I can’t find it?

If nori isn’t available, you can use lettuce leaves or rice paper as a wrap. They won’t have the same flavor, but they’ll still hold your delicious filling!

How do I store leftover wraps?

Store any leftover Tuna & Seaweed Mini Wraps in an airtight container in the fridge. They’re best enjoyed within a few hours, but they can last up to a day.

Can I customize the fillings in these wraps?

Absolutely! Feel free to add your favorite veggies or proteins. Shredded carrots, bell peppers, or even cooked shrimp can make delightful additions.

Description

Tuna & Seaweed Mini Wraps are a delicious and healthy snack option, perfect for a quick bite or a light meal.


Ingredients

Scale
  • 1 can of tuna, drained
  • 2 tablespoons mayonnaise
  • 1 teaspoon soy sauce
  • 4 sheets of nori (seaweed)
  • 1 cucumber, thinly sliced
  • 1 avocado, sliced
  • Sesame seeds for garnish

Instructions

  1. In a bowl, mix the drained tuna with mayonnaise and soy sauce until well combined.
  2. Lay a sheet of nori on a flat surface.
  3. Spread a thin layer of the tuna mixture over the nori.
  4. Add slices of cucumber and avocado on top of the tuna.
  5. Carefully roll the nori tightly to form a wrap.
  6. Repeat the process with the remaining ingredients.
  7. Slice the wraps into bite-sized pieces and sprinkle with sesame seeds before serving.

Notes

  • For added flavor, consider adding chopped green onions or a dash of sriracha to the tuna mixture.
  • These wraps are best served fresh but can be stored in the refrigerator for a few hours.
  • Feel free to customize the fillings based on your preferences.
